How they compare
Norway currently reports 7.06 against 6.86 in Belarus, a difference of 0.2.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 21 shared years of data; in 2003 it was Norway ahead.
Belarus ranks 44th and Norway ranks 43rd of 120 countries.
Norway has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belarus | Norway |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5.05 | 11.68 | 6.63 | Norway |
| 2010s | 6.97 | 10.26 | 3.29 | Norway |
| 2020s | 7.25 | 7.48 | 0.2299 | Norway |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
